Asterales
Modern Cuisine · ★ Michelin
€€€
Poetically named after an order of flowering plants, this tasteful restaurant sports a low-key alpine style. Chef Ludovic Nardozza’s painstakingly crafted cooking showcases his favourite, first-class ingredients: roasted langoustines in marjoram butter, girolles and vin jaune bisque; John Dory lacquered in wild fennel, courgette flowers and grilled cuttlefish; apple like an upside-down pie with local honey and black cardamon… Service with a smile. Pleasant guestrooms make it an ideal basecamp to explore Vercors.

Café Brochier
Modern Cuisine · Bib
€€
This handsome building is an institution in this Vercors village. Dating from 1867, it is home to a historical cafe adorned with frescoes dating back to 1912. Locally sourced ingredients from the Vercors plateau play the lead roles on the menu, which changes regularly. Respect for the seasons goes hand in hand with respect for the produce, culinary skill and flavour. Three guestrooms upstairs.

Le Chalet
Traditional Cuisine
€€
A fortified house during the Middle Ages, and a convent up until 1905, this "chalet" is now a hotel-restaurant run by the Prayer family, for whom tradition and generosity are the answer to everything. Their big-boned, wholehearted score reads like a vintage cookbook: hare pâté, fillet of trout and crayfish and Dauphiné ravioles, or a melt-in-the-mouth chocolate and vanilla ice cream extravaganza. Cosy rooms for overnight stays.
